						 <description><![CDATA[<p>The June 18th Downtown Council meeting will be on the River&hellip;literally!&nbsp; Come aboard the River Taxi docked at Friendship Park on the Southbank for a one-hour appreciation tour of the River.&nbsp; Join us and Riverkeeper Neil Armingeon to learn things about the river you probably never knew.&nbsp; Neil will also bring us up to date on what the Legislature has done both to protect and possibly endanger our water supply, a landmark Federal Court ruling on the lawsuit against JEA&rsquo;s discharges into the St. Johns river, and whether or not the river may see the return of the Green Monster this summer.</p>

						 <description><![CDATA[<p>The Downtown Council Education Committee partnered with Julia Landon College Preparatory and Leadership Development School to provide support and mentorship to the Eighth Grade Multi-media project.&nbsp; The 8th grade students were given an assignment to create a short film on topics related to global awareness.&nbsp; Working in small teams, the eighth graders presented their works in progress to a panel Downtown Council members who provided feedback to the students.&nbsp; The students then finished their projects and submitted them for judging.</p>
<p><br />The winner for the Best Overall Multi-media Presentation, was selected, from more than 30 student films.&nbsp; The sensitive storytelling of the short video, Ukraine Adoption demonstrated the abilities of these students to work together on a creative and technical level.</p>
<p>The video may be seen on the School&rsquo;s web site here:<br /><a title="Landon Website" href="http://www.duvalschools.org/landon/leadership.htm" target="_blank">www.duvalschools.org/landon/leadership.htm</a></p>
<p><br />Cynthia Farmer, Education Committee Co-chair presented the winners with the award at the Julia Landon 2010 Global Awareness Symposium.&nbsp; The winners and their parents were also special guests at the May 21st Downtown Council Breakfast Meeting where the video was shown.&nbsp; In attendance were 8th grade students Nicole, Galina, Brooke and their parents.&nbsp; Landon faculty, Andrew Lorentz, Curriculum Integration Specialist, and Anna Peacock-Preston, Critical Thinking Instructor supervised the school&rsquo;s project.&nbsp;</p>

						 <description><![CDATA[<p>Downtown Vision, Inc. (DVI) is the Downtown Improvement District (DID) for Downtown Jacksonville. DVI is a not-for-profit 501(c)6 organization whose mission is to build and maintain a healthy and vibrant Downtown community and to promote Downtown as an exciting place to live, work, play and visit.</p>
<p><br />The attached paper discusses the 2.72-square mile urban community redevelopment area bounded by State Street to the north, I-95 to the west and south and the St. Johns River to the east. The terms &ldquo;urban core,&rdquo; &ldquo;walkable core&rdquo; or &ldquo;core&rdquo; refer to the walkable area of Downtown Jacksonville consisting of approximately 25 blocks on the Northbank centered on Laura Street, plus the Southbank Riverwalk and Friendship Fountain area, which is accessible to pedestrians via the Main Street Bridge and water taxi. The core contains the three major &ldquo;nodes&rdquo; of Downtown activity including The Jacksonville Landing/Times-Union Center for the Performing Arts, the Hemming Plaza government and cultural center, and the emerging entertainment district around Bay, Forsyth and Adams Streets, anchored by the Florida Theatre..</p>
